How are the hidden pictures concealed within the puzzle?
Hidden pictures are concealed within puzzles by camouflaging them with other elements and patterns, making it challenging for individuals to spot them at first glance. These pictures are often integrated seamlessly into the overall design or background, requiring keen observation and critical thinking skills to uncover them. It could also involve manipulating colors, shapes, and shading to obscure the hidden images and create a sense of mystery for the solver to unravel.
